Kolkata Weather Casts Shadow Over Crucial T20 World Cup Super Eight Clash

The highly anticipated Super Eight match between India and West Indies in the T20 World Cup 2026 is facing potential disruption due to uncertain weather conditions in Kolkata. Cricket fans and organizers are closely monitoring the forecast as rain threatens to play spoilsport in this critical encounter.

Uncertain Forecast Raises Concerns

Meteorological reports indicate a significant chance of precipitation in Kolkata around the scheduled match time. The city, known for its unpredictable weather patterns during this season, could experience showers that might delay or even interrupt the game. This has prompted both teams to prepare contingency plans and adjust their strategies accordingly.

The match holds immense importance in the tournament's Super Eight stage, where every point matters for progression to the semifinals. A washout or reduced-overs game could dramatically impact the standings and qualification scenarios for both sides.

Venue Preparedness and Historical Context

Eden Gardens, the historic venue hosting the match, has adequate drainage facilities, but persistent rain could still pose challenges. Ground staff are on high alert, ready with covers and super-soppers to minimize disruption if weather conditions deteriorate.

Kolkata has experienced weather-affected matches in past tournaments, adding to the anxiety among players and supporters. The Indian cricket team, in particular, will be hoping for clear skies as they seek to maintain momentum in their home conditions.

Potential Scenarios and Tournament Implications

  • Full Match Played: Ideal scenario with no weather interference
  • Reduced-Overs Game: Likely if rain causes delays but subsides
  • Complete Washout: Both teams share points, affecting net run rate
  • Rescheduled Match: Possible if tournament schedule allows flexibility

The International Cricket Council (ICC) has protocols for weather-affected matches, including reserve days for knockout stages, but Super Eight matches typically don't have this provision. This increases pressure on teams to secure results within the scheduled playing time.
